Dataset Card for CentralDogma

Summary

The CentralDogma dataset is part of the LUCAONE downstream tasks collection for biomolecular interaction prediction. It is structured for binary classification and includes standard splits for training (train.csv), validation (dev.csvval), and test (test.csv).

Dataset Structure

This dataset includes three splits:

  • train
  • val (converted from dev.csv)
  • test

Each split is in CSV format.

Task

Binary classification of interactions between biomolecular entities.

Source Path

Original download path: http://47.93.21.181/lucaone/DownstreamTasksDataset/dataset/CentralDogma/gene_protein/binary_class/

Example Use

from datasets import load_dataset

ds = load_dataset("vladak/CentralDogma")
print(ds["train"][0])
